WebFrom lush, green rainforests to stark limestone tsingy formations to the dry spiny desert, Madagascar has a huge range of ecosystems, geography, and microclimates—and every area supports its own endemic species. Berenty, in the south, is the best place to see dancing sifaka lemurs, while Ankarana, in the north, is home to crowned lemurs. WebNov 26, 2024 · Forest of Knives, Madagascar These razor-sharp vertical limestone rocks in Madagascar (an island off the coast of South Africa), are also known as Tsingy, in Malagasy. This means “the place that one cannot walk”, and there is no doubt as to why. WebThe Ankarana National Park is one of the most visited tourist sites in Northern Madagascar. It derives its fame from its Tsingy, its rich biodiversity, and its ancestral traditions. The Ankarana Special Reserve (Rserve Spciale or RS) was created in 1956 by the colonial authorities and has full legal protection.
